



Gerber Bear Grylls Survival Belt
The Gerber Bear Grylls Survival Belt is a very cleverly designed belt that offers a lot more than just a way to keep your trousers up.
The Gerber Bear Grylls Survival Belt is made of heavy nylon webbing that will prove long-lasting and it features a clever buckle.
This buckle operates normally but, in addition, the back of it will twist off and the lid reveals a mirror set into it for signalling if required but otherwise of general use as a personal mirror.
In the compartment revealed by taking the lid off is a plastic bag containing a complete and practical survival fishing kit that includes a fishing line, fishing hooks, fishing weights and a snare wire.
Then the back of the buckle has a slot to accommodate a detachable mini screwdriver with both flat and Philips drivers.
And even that is not all as at the rear of the belt there is a hidden pocket with a zip which stores the Priorities of Survival Guide.
